  • Flexicon's Bulk Bag Conditioner loosens solidified materials

    The Block-Buster™ Bulk Bag Conditioner developed by Flexicon is designed to loosen material that has solidified during storage or shipment, enabling bulk bag unloaders to discharge more easily and fully through bag spouts.

  • Independent Meter Testing Service Launches by MWA

    MWA Technology Limited, an independent metering supplier based in Birmingham, has launched a meter testing service for any brand of rotary or turbine meter with flow rate capacities from one cubic metre per hour to 650 cubic metres per hour.

  • Call for action on illegal and dangerous meter connections

    Two business executives are expressing concern about industry estimates that 90 percent of connections to third party UK primary gas meters are illegal.

  • "Super Luxury" at Grosvenor House Apartments

    This £100m refurbishment project has produced a total of 133 “super luxury” short-term rental serviced apartments at one of country’s most prestigious addresses – the Grosvenor House on London’s Park Lane. The apartments range from studios to five bedroom penthouses, many with fine views across Hyde Park.

  • Disabled Workers could be left stranded in emergencies, according to research by Evac Chair International

    One in two companies is under prepared for evacuations in the workplace and wheelchair users and the mobility-impaired are most at risk from being unable to make a safe escape, according to a survey by evacuation specialists, Evac+Chair International.
